I should have read the reviews before I made this as mine too burned on the bottom. I'm pretty sure this was due to the sugar/butter running off the tart, onto the parchment paper and then under the tart. I'm not sure how to fix this (suggestions?? - perhaps turning the edges of the puff pastry to form a border would help. These are so easy that I will definitely give them another try, perhaps turning the oven down to 375 and/or using convection bake.
